Core Viewpoint - Jinbo Co., Ltd. has shown a significant increase in stock price and trading activity, indicating positive market sentiment despite a decline in net profit for the year [1][2]. Group 1: Stock Performance - On December 29, Jinbo's stock rose by 2.03%, reaching 30.60 CNY per share, with a trading volume of 61.21 million CNY and a turnover rate of 0.99%, resulting in a total market capitalization of 6.35 billion CNY [1]. - Year-to-date, Jinbo's stock price has increased by 45.30%, with a 9.29% rise over the last five trading days, a 4.15% increase over the last 20 days, and a 9.95% decline over the last 60 days [1]. Group 2: Financial Performance - For the period from January to September 2025, Jinbo achieved a revenue of 618 million CNY,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 40.34%. However, the net profit attributable to shareholders was -276 million CNY, a decrease of 88.84% compared to the previous year [2]. Group 3: Shareholder Information - As of September 30, 2025, Jinbo had 14,300 shareholders, an increase of 7.13% from the previous period, with an average of 14,262 circulating shares per shareholder, down by 6.66% [2]. - The company has distributed a total of 104 million CNY in dividends since its A-share listing, with 23.52 million CNY distributed over the last three years [3]. - Notable changes in institutional holdings include a decrease in shares held by major shareholders such as Invesco Great Wall New Energy Industry Fund and Hong Kong Central Clearing Limited, while a new entry was noted from Guotai Junan Growth Flexible Allocation Mixed Fund [3].
